Output e96fabbb3253620bb3d66c6a6ef1bc4433555e7b648373fbbba6ac49bdd1bf8d:0

value
13408829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a3fbb564e4e0b7947a23abc4dafd080eb5f195 OP_EQUAL
address
34ktfdSpniGN78Dx9CetDnzfTyTDSNdeLu
transaction
e96fabbb3253620bb3d66c6a6ef1bc4433555e7b648373fbbba6ac49bdd1bf8d
spent
true